Comment

You already know a few nationalities and understand that if the writer is French (male), you would say ‘français’ and if the writer was French (female) you would say (‘française). However, if the nationality already ends in -e, like ‘belge’ (Belgian), you don’t add a further -e for the feminine form. This means that the spelling is the same for masculine and feminine.
